City Guide
Rancho Tehama Reserve, California, United States
Overview
Rancho Tehama Reserve is a secluded, unincorporated rural community in Tehama County, California. The area is known for its wide-open spaces, country living, and quiet atmosphere, attracting those who prefer a slower pace and natural surroundings.
Best Time to Visit
April-June and September-October for pleasant weather and fewer crowds.
Local Tips
Personal vehicles are important as public transport is limited; bring groceries and essentials as shopping options are minimal within the community.
Cultural Etiquette
Casual attire is the norm; be respectful of private property and rural customs. Standard U.S. tipping (15-20% at restaurants, if available) applies.
Safety Warnings
Some areas can feel isolated; check local news for updates on wildfires or road conditions. Emergency services and cell reception may be limited in remote spots.
Hidden Gems
Explore local hiking paths, enjoy birdwatching at nearby creeks, and visit small community events for an authentic rural California experience.
